Ratipur Population - Palwal, Haryana

Ratipur is a medium size village located in Palwal Tehsil of Palwal district, Haryana with total 336 families residing. The Ratipur village has population of 1828 of which 975 are males while 853 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Ratipur village population of children with age 0-6 is 275 which makes up 15.04 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Ratipur village is 875 which is lower than Haryana state average of 879. Child Sex Ratio for the Ratipur as per census is 786, lower than Haryana average of 834.

Ratipur village has higher literacy rate compared to Haryana. In 2011, literacy rate of Ratipur village was 78.49 % compared to 75.55 % of Haryana. In Ratipur Male literacy stands at 92.08 % while female literacy rate was 63.25 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 11.60 % of total population in Ratipur village. The village Ratipur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Ratipur village out of total population, 463 were engaged in work activities. 98.92 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.08 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 463 workers engaged in Main Work, 127 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 2 were Agricultural labourer.
